乐趣区

关于devops:将DevOps践行到底禅道DevOps黑客马拉松挑战赛圆满落幕-IDCF

3 月 27-28 日,由 IDCF、禅道、英捷创软联结主办,科大讯飞协办的“禅道 DevOps 黑客马拉松挑战赛”在青岛科大讯飞将来港举办。

流动完结后,IDCF 联结发起人王立杰老师采访了禅道创始人王春生老师,在采访中王春生老师如是说:

通过 2 天的 DevOps 黑客马拉松挑战赛,咱们的团队残缺体验和实际了 DevOps 端到端的过程。对我集体而言,我感觉第二增长曲线、用户画像、用户故事地图、影响地图都是十分好的工具,而且较量自身很乏味,通过较量发现团队成员多才多艺的一面。接下来咱们会持续推动落地 DevOps,以此来帮忙团队和客户解决研发中相似的问题。

禅道是一款业余的项目管理软件。它集产品治理、项目管理、品质治理、文档治理、组织治理和事务管理于一体,残缺笼罩了研发项目管理的外围流程。自 2009 年公布至今已为国内数十万计的公司或团队提供了业余的项目管理工具。

此次与 IDCF 联结组织“禅道 DevOps 黑客马拉松挑战赛”,在禅道创始人王春生看来,既是让禅道团队残缺学习并实际 DevOps 的精华,同时也是为了更加系统地把握 DevOps 的办法,在客户我的项目服务的过程中,帮忙客户更好地利用 DevOps,实现客户胜利。

本次“禅道 DevOps 黑客马拉松挑战赛”仍旧模仿实在业务场景,以帮忙船屋餐厅寻找第二增长曲线为背景,来自禅道软件、科大讯飞、赛轮团体、河北视窗信息、华能信息、澳杰软件、云智慧、大彩文化创意、以萨数据、小树成材教育等多个企业的 80 名参赛者,分为 8 个小组,在专属教练王立杰老师、徐磊老师,以及特邀教练姚冬老师、周文洋老师的率领下,历经 36 个小时体验 DevOps 的残缺流程,从 0 到 1 打造一款产品,零碎学习麻利项目管理办法,独特拆解端到端的 DevOps 体系和技能图谱。

36 小时,用 DevOps 办法进行一次残缺的守业

守业是一件痛并高兴的事件,守业的过程充斥着机会、惊喜和挑战,在互联网高速倒退的趋势下,没有任何一个团队能够稳坐钓鱼台,守业气氛是最有战斗力、凝聚力、成长力的团队气氛。

DevOps 黑客马拉松以一家受疫情影响导致业务下滑急需寻找第二增长曲线的餐厅为背景,在 36 个小时内经验 7 个模块,使用迷信的 DevOps 办法,从商业模式布局开始到我的项目路演完结,残缺经验一次守业。

DevOps 黑客马拉松 7 大模块包含:

  • 模块一:学习端到端 DevOps 5P 框架,根本认知 DevOps 理念及办法;
  • 模块二:商业模式翻新,通过商业模式画布,为我的项目设计一个性感的商业模式,寻找增长第二曲线;
  • 模块三:产品性能布局,通过用户画像摸索标签及痛点,利用用户故事地图梳理产品外围性能,梳理产品愿景、定义产品外围价值,构建产品 MVP 原型;
  • 模块四:制订产品迭代打算,学习把握迭代指标设计、工作拆解与认领等技巧,设立物理看板并筹备执行;
  • 模块五:现场打造继续交付流水线,搭建开发环境与分支策略,搭建继续交付流水线,梳理微服务架构并实现第一个迭代 MVP 版本的线上交付;
  • 模块六:应用影响地图梳理产品冷启动布局;
  • 模块七:讲演我的项目计划并演示产品 Demo,各组 PK 决胜。

这 7 个模块的历程将 1 年甚至更长的守业经验稀释在了 36 个小时内,并且让每一位参赛者可能跳出以后业务、岗位的禁锢,学习从全局角度登程,来思考业务存在的时机、挑战与破局点。

学练赛一体化培训,DevOps 畛域大咖手把手领导

在 DevOps 黑客马拉松的较量过程中,DevOps 畛域大咖王立杰、徐磊、姚冬、周文洋四位老师具体解说了各环节应用的工具和办法,培训后疾速进入实战练习环节,应用所学办法利用于业务实际,四位老师亲临每个战队领导具体实际形式,并提出修改意见。

最初进行我的项目计划的现场路演,通过讲演与专家点评,找出我的项目的有余与亮点并进行评奖。

本次“禅道 DevOps 黑客马拉松挑战赛”共计 80 名参赛者,8 支参赛队伍,全副在 36 小时内实现我的项目创意及 Demo 开发交付,挑战胜利!

并且,本次较量还创下了多个历届 DevOps 黑客马拉松的第一:

  • 在影响地图环节,本届黑马产出历史最长影响地图;
  • 在流水线搭建环节,美少女与兵士队创历届流水线搭建最低用时记录,所有团队创历届实现加分项最多记录;
  • 在用户画像环节中,多个小组参赛队伍体现出超强画工,用户画像的出现成果为历史之最;

  • 路演环节各小组顶住了投资人问题的暴击,我的项目方与点评组的攻防精彩水平为历史之最;
  • 黑马精力奖评比比分胶着,首次应用了加赛的形式决出最佳黑马精力奖。

通过多个轮比赛及路演环节的 PK,各项大奖也纷纷揭晓:

👑美少女与兵士队取得了最佳黑马团队奖及最佳流水线奖

👑由小树成材公司打造的“小船食育 APP” 取得了最佳创意奖;

👑振华团体队取得了最佳黑马精力奖

👑禅道团队的王志强取得了最佳演讲个人奖

回绝干燥的学习,享受极客精力带来的比赛乐趣

DevOps 黑客马拉松是专属于开发者的流动,流动过程辞别了干燥的学习形式,在各环节中融入了乏味好玩的游戏挑战。

在传统保留节目啤酒大赛环节,山东选手果然名不副实,发明了历届黑马喝啤酒最快纪录。在青岛,喝青岛啤酒,亮极客精力。

济南大彩文化创始人郭琳在赛后采访中示意:

可能在流动中感触残缺的从 0 到 1 的守业经验是特地难得的过程,更难得的是还有业余的办法来领导守业过程中每一个重要的环节,例如在产品冷启动环节的影响地图工具,可能一层一层地将动作拆解落地,并且可能和生疏的搭档一起成立长期团队,一起碰撞、答辩、实际、迭代,跳出思维局限,关上思路和视线。

赛后采访

一个感动你的知识点

刘刚 - 研发经理 - 禅道:播种十分多,精益画布、用户画像、用户故事地图、用户影响地图都是十分实用的工具,教会咱们如何从 0 到 1 打造一款产品。而作为一个技术人员,最大的播种还是流水线的搭建。以前对于 Jenkins、Jmeter、Junit、Selenium 这些工具都有所理解,但没有系统地实际过,通过这次流动根本把握了流水线的搭建办法,也领会到了继续集成、继续公布的便利性。这些正是咱们目前工作中须要的,接下来咱们会继续发展相干的工作。

徐贺 - 销售 - 禅道:对于后果而言,能力往往是主要的,最重要的是执行力。

石洋洋 - 技术支持 - 禅道:理解了整个商业计划书的内容及细节。

李硕 - 研发 - 禅道:用户画像,能够理解客户的状况,深入分析到底本人的客户是什么样子。

康秀娟 - 研发效力负责人 - 云智慧:最感动我的是看到大家在短短的两天工夫有这么多产出。最喜爱的是商业路演环节,让大家把两天所学正式地总结进去,分享给大家。尤其是咱们团队,来自四个公司,四个行业的长期团队,从最开始的反抗,到最初独特产出“小船食育”这个创意,甚至大家都想把它连续到线下继续来做。这真的是在最开始几乎不敢设想的。

郭海乔 -Java 开发工程师 - 赛轮:DevOps 提倡“开发运维一体化”,但不是“谁开发谁运维”,而是使开发和运维通过一些机制有机联合、高效对立,成为一个整体,从而打消开发团队和运维团队之间的 gap,无效晋升应用服务的研发和运维经营效率。

王光 -Java 开发工程师 - 赛轮:DevOps 的外围是精益与麻利的思维和准则,DevOps 没有明确的定义,一个好的方法论,应该是与时俱进,兼容并蓄的;应该是凋谢的,演进的而不是固化的,好的办法和实际咱们都是能够放进去的,工欲善其事必先利其器。

许斌 - 开发经理 - 赛轮:麻利开发与瀑布开发的最大区别,就是一直试错,而不是把所有性能明细布局到极致再开始开发,故瀑布开发实用于已有成熟零碎、可参考的零碎开发;麻利开发适宜于翻新事务或零碎的开发,以最小老本试错,在实践中进行优化迭代。

一个立刻能用的工作办法

刘刚 - 研发经理 - 禅道:精益画布、用户画像。

徐贺 - 销售 - 禅道:先动起来,不要破费太多的工夫在探讨上。

石洋洋 - 技术支持 - 禅道:商业画布 9 宫格。

李硕 - 研发 - 禅道:MVP 最小模型,对于一些定制开发的客户,先实现一个根底 demo,能够帮忙理解客户实在想法,缩小老本节约。

康秀娟 - 研发效力负责人 - 云智慧:影响地图。能够立刻应用到目前的新性能交付或者我的项目交付中。从近期的外围指标登程,逐渐推演出外围聚焦的性能。

郭海乔 -Java 开发工程师 - 赛轮:Jenkins 自动化部署工具。

王光 -Java 开发工程师 - 赛轮:提供服务部署能力的 Jenkins 流水线。

许斌 - 开发经理 - 赛轮:Selenium 自动化 UI 测试,Jenkins 流水线部署,Junit 单元测试,Jmeter 自动化接口测试,K8S 环境部署。

一个当初开始的口头

刘刚 - 研发经理 - 禅道:先开始流水线的搭建,从继续集成、继续公布开始,逐步推进 DevOps 的落地。

徐贺 - 销售 - 禅道:管理者的职责应该是协调团队的工作,而不是作为一个业余人员闷头苦干。

石洋洋 - 技术支持 - 禅道:画画好了,用的中央还是挺多的。

李硕 - 研发 - 禅道:第二曲线,做好本职,但同时也要筹备好另一个能够持续成长的技术赛道。

康秀娟 - 研发效力负责人 - 云智慧:尽快开始做本次流动的播种总结。举荐给产品研发运维交付部门的老大,让大家看到 DevOps 的价值,也想在公司产研中层治理团队组织一次黑马培训。

郭海乔 -Java 开发工程师 - 赛轮:搭建 Jenkins,实现微服务项目的自动化部署,进步运维效率。

王光 -Java 开发工程师 - 赛轮:继续集成工具 Jenkins 钻研学习,使用到我的项目的开发部署中。

许斌 - 开发经理 - 赛轮:在团体外部申请测试服务器,搭建 Docker,Jenkins,Gitlab,Nexus Sonarqube,对外部开发人员分配任务,对每个工具进行技术预研,把握工具部署应用,为 PaaS 平台储备人才。

参赛体验

刘刚 - 研发经理 - 禅道:课程内容十分紧凑,一个环节接着一个环节。后期咱们进行了强烈的探讨,大家提出了很多新鲜的想法,最终确定了程序员港湾这个计划。流水线搭建环节呈现后,咱们很快做出了布局,开发人员全身心投入流水线的搭建,其他人被动承包了接下来的工作环节。分工明确各司其职带来的益处就是能够聚精会神地做本人负责的工作不受烦扰。最终咱们获得了用户画像和流水线搭建两个环节分项第一的好问题。用户画像惊艳到了我,团队成员的画功十分棒。

徐贺 - 销售 - 禅道:抱着学习的心态参加,你会播种更多。

石洋洋 - 技术支持 - 禅道:体验了整个 DevOps 黑客马拉松的过程,扩大了思维。

李硕 - 研发 - 禅道:节奏十分紧凑,感触到了团队分工合作的高效和高兴。

康秀娟 - 研发效力负责人 - 云智慧:十分棒的体验之旅,播种了很多干货,也播种了很多良师益友

郭海乔 -Java 开发工程师 - 赛轮:通过两天一夜的培训挑战,在咱们 6 组整体组员的群策群力下实现了各项挑战。从刚开始创意的强烈探讨,到前面各项挑战的井井有条的分工协作,尽管没有取得奖品,但也获得了第二名的好问题,也算是对咱们付出的回报。

王光 -Java 开发工程师 - 赛轮:DevOps 不仅仅局限在开发和运维之间的合作,作为程序员要进行思维转变,可能更麻利端到端打造产品。在流动中,大家对船屋进行商业模式翻新,从无到有去打造一款产品,通过团队成员的合作、思维的碰撞、产品的优化实在感触 DevOps 在理论场景的体现,更好地感触 DevOps 思维。对于开发人员来说,要把继续摸索、继续集成、继续部署和按需公布等外围实际使用到我的项目中。

许斌 - 开发经理 - 赛轮:在两天一夜的参赛过程中,学习了一个产品从用户需要到商业路演整个过程,包含商业模式的翻新、产品性能布局、迭代打算、继续交付流水线、商业路演,为后续团体零碎产品化开启了新的思路。

想要进一步摸索的问题

刘刚 - 研发经理 - 禅道:想进一步学习自动化代码扫描、自动化测试相干的常识,这是咱们目前特地须要的。

李硕 - 研发 - 禅道:因为不是很相熟,所以不晓得 DevOps 是否能够提炼出一种方法论,用于生存或者工作里的事务处理?

康秀娟 - 研发效力负责人 - 云智慧:针对每一项工具和实际,如何切实地落地到日常工作中?如何深刻地导入到团队中产生变动和价值。接下来想更深刻地理解和转化,帮忙解决工作瓶颈和问题。

结 语

大量的工程实际经验和 DevOps 我的项目教训通知咱们,团队的成长来自于一直的实际,但当咱们陷入到以后业务中时,咱们的思维也就陷入了窘境。

很多创始人或团队管理者常常苦恼于团队外围骨干和本人在视线、思路上的不同频,特地是对于一些业务绝对稳固的开发团队来说,翻新往往停留于外表。

IDCF 策动的 DevOps 黑客马拉松流动已举办到第 10 期,参赛者均感叹于 DevOps 黑马带来的难得的守业气氛,以及在守业历程中的迷信办法和工具。

咱们心愿有更多人退出到 DevOps 黑客马拉松流动中来,跳出思维局限,突破认知避障,从商业角度从新思考、扫视业务方向,建设团队对立、共识、协同的 DevOps 工作法。

【2021 IDCF 公开课招生 ing】

2021 年《IDCF DevOps 黑客马拉松》北京、深圳、上海站开启,还有《端到端 DevOps 继续交付(5P)工作坊》、《基于 Boat House 的 DevOps 实际》、《“翻新设计思维 /Design Thinking”工作坊》、《麻利项目管理实战沙盘演练》等泛滥公开课能够加入,快快报名吧~(公众号回复“公开课”报名征询)

退出移动版